Church of Saint Anne in Dětřichov is an important cultural monument in XZ1 The Czech Republic. Initially built around the transition from 13th to 14th century, it began to take its present form to 1409. The church has almost a square boat and an eastward protruding presbytery, typical of Frýdlant's lands at this time. In 1720 it underwent a Baroque reconstruction which included the addition of semi-circular presbytery and sacristy. Despite the period of neglect, the church remains protected as a cultural monument.

Historical sources suggest construction around the transition from 13th to 14th century, with its first documented mention in 1619, when the tower was added to the western facade.

The Church of Saint Anne belongs to churches that feature almost square ships and exit exiting presbyters. The Baroque renovation changed it significantly in 1720, adding a semi-circular presbytery and sacristy to the south, moving its style to a more ornamental Baroque aesthetic. In 1889-1890 the tower was raised.

Throughout his history, the Church of Saint Anne experienced various administrative changes and riches. After the renovation in 1720, she faced neglect, especially after World War II, when she was embarrassed. Minimum maintenance efforts have been made since 1989.

Remarkable curiosity is the history of his organs. Originally built Ambroz Augustin Tauchman at the end of the 18th century, the organ was reconfigured by Friedrich Christian Reiß in 1842, who moved the positives to the main playing mechanism. In 1860 it was cleaned, tuned and repaired, with other ornaments added over time.

In recent development, the modern passageway around the church was restored in 2023 through contributions from the Czech-German Fund. This renewal reflects continued efforts to preserve the cultural heritage of the Church of Saint Anne. The new equipment was made using a melted glass Spider Glass from nearby Hermanics.

Architectural development

Originally part of a group of churches from the end of the 13th and the beginning of the 14th century is the church of St. Anne with an almost square boat with an exit protruding presbytery. In 1720 it was transformed into a baroque style and to the south added half-circle presbytery and sacristy. The tower was raised between 1889-1890. Despite its historical significance, neglect after 1945 led to minimal maintenance until 1989.
